Over more than two decades, Sierra Club California and our allies have been pushing state agencies and the legislature to accelerate adoption of zero-emission vehicles.
 
We’ve seen progress. There are nearly 50 models of zero-emission light-duty vehicles in the California market, and more are expected. The driving range on a charge for some models is as long as with many gasoline vehicles.

This was a fun and informative event, learning about the different types of Electric Vehicles (EV's), seeing all these cool vehicles in one place, and meeting their very proud owners. The exhibits included all-electric and plug-in hybrid-electric cars, trucks, and motorcycles. The owners all swear they’d never go back to a gasoline-powered vehicle again!
